Amazon's Fire OS is android but they've announced a new webOS ripoff, VegaOS, Linux running HTML5/react apps. Normally I'd think this kind of diversity is a good thing, but apparently it's locked down even tighter and side loading into Vega OS just isn't a thing at all.

Edit: the point I was trying to make is that some vendors are working to get away from Google's Android foundations completely. I would think that graphene could go that route if the rug was pulled. But good luck with device support when the device specific source isn't released.
